Aim: We investigated the association of red blood cell distribution width-albumin ratio (RAR) with prognosis and clinical risk scores in patients with acute coronary syndrome (ACS). Material and Methods: A total of 245 patients with ACS were retrospectively evaluated. RAR levels were obtained by dividing RDW by albumin. RAR was divided into two groups based on the cut-off value, with low and high RAR. All parameters were statistically compared between these groups. The correlation of RAR with risk scores was also evaluated. Results: Receiver operating characteristic (ROC) analysis revealed that albumin and RAR exhibited the highest values in mortality prediction (Area Under Curve [AUC]: 0.961, 0.951 respectively). The RAR exhibited a significant positive correlation with the troponin I, TIMI (thrombolysis in myocardial infarction), and HEART (history, EKG, age, risk factors, and troponin) risk scores (p < 0.05 for all). Discussion: RAR levels on admission may be a more powerful predictor of mortality than RDW, TIMI and HEART risk scores in patients with ACS. High RAR levels can readily identify those at high risk in these patients and can also predict adverse outcomes. In the prognostic risk classification of ACS patients, the RAR has high sensitivity and specificity with a cut-off value of 0.403.
